Performance Limitations and Wallet Considerations
One honest flaw we noticed is that not all M.2 slots support NVMe, especially on older motherboards. This means you might not get the full speed benefit without upgrading your motherboard, which could be a big cash out. So, if you’re planning to upgrade, check if your M.2 slot supports NVMe first.
Additionally, faster NVMe drives can be pricier, so your wallet might feel the pinch if you go all-in on top-tier storage. Remember, this involves real money and financial risk, so weigh your options carefully before investing in high-end SSDs for your gaming PC.

Wallet Cash Flow: How NVMe and M.2 Impact Your Budget
In the Philippine market, the way your PC handles data through NVMe or M.2 slots can influence your gaming experience and wallet cash flow. NVMe drives are faster, which means quicker load times and smoother gameplay—good for avoiding lag that could lead to unnecessary load or reload costs. But, they tend to be more expensive, so your initial cash out might be higher.
On the other hand, M.2 slots support both SATA and NVMe SSDs, often at a lower price point. If your budget is tight, choosing a SATA M.2 SSD can save PHP while still improving load times compared to traditional HDDs.
